SANTA, Ancash — According to the U.S. Geological Survey, a 5.0 magnitude quake rattled close to Puerto Santa Wednesday evening.

It was reported that a tremor struck the region at 00:54 UTC (19:54 local time). The epicenter was situated about 36 km west of Puerto Santa, at a depth of 68 km.

So far, the agency has collected 8 online responses from individuals reporting that they felt the quake. Light to moderate shaking was observed, with reports from cities such as Trujillo and Moche indicating that the tremor was felt, according to the USGS DYFI report.
